[sr-dev] git:master:6752351b: websocket: use route_lookup() instead of route_get()

Daniel-Constantin Mierla miconda at gmail.com
Fri Aug 4 14:37:48 CEST 2017


Module: kamailio
Branch: master
Commit: 6752351b69cd991cd11f389f80cf73bd68ff5bb9
URL: https://github.com/kamailio/kamailio/commit/6752351b69cd991cd11f389f80cf73bd68ff5bb9

Author: Daniel-Constantin Mierla <miconda at gmail.com>
Committer: Daniel-Constantin Mierla <miconda at gmail.com>
Date: 2017-08-04T14:36:42+02:00

websocket: use route_lookup() instead of route_get()

- avoid creating an empty route block structure if not defined in cfg

---

Modified: src/modules/websocket/ws_conn.c

---

Diff:  https://github.com/kamailio/kamailio/commit/6752351b69cd991cd11f389f80cf73bd68ff5bb9.diff
Patch: https://github.com/kamailio/kamailio/commit/6752351b69cd991cd11f389f80cf73bd68ff5bb9.patch

---

diff --git a/src/modules/websocket/ws_conn.c b/src/modules/websocket/ws_conn.c
index ad3d216a83..3fd9207dcf 100644
--- a/src/modules/websocket/ws_conn.c
+++ b/src/modules/websocket/ws_conn.c
@@ -279,7 +279,7 @@ static void wsconn_run_route(ws_connection_t *wsc)
 
 	LM_DBG("wsconn_run_route event_route[websocket:closed]\n");
 
-	rt = route_get(&event_rt, "websocket:closed");
+	rt = route_lookup(&event_rt, "websocket:closed");
 	if (rt < 0 || event_rt.rlist[rt] == NULL)
 	{
 		LM_DBG("route does not exist");
@@ -291,7 +291,7 @@ static void wsconn_run_route(ws_connection_t *wsc)
 		LM_ERR("faked_msg_init() failed\n");
 		return;
 	}
-	
+
 	fmsg = faked_msg_next();
 	wsc->rcv.proto_reserved1 = wsc->id;
 	fmsg->rcv = wsc->rcv;




More information about the sr-dev mailing list